What are the implications of not calling the organ procurement organization?

Not calling the organ procurement organization (OPO) can lead to missed opportunities for organ donation, resulting in potential lives lost due to a shortage of available organs for transplant. It may also violate legal and ethical obligations, as healthcare providers are often required to notify the OPO when a patient meets certain criteria. Additionally, failing to engage the OPO can create emotional distress for families who may not be aware of their options for donation, ultimately impacting the overall efficiency of the transplant system.
